Prams can be used from the time of birth, and some come with a carrycot which can also serve as a moses-basket if your child is old enough to be able to sleep there.

A pushchair is a compact option, made to accommodate older babies and toddlers who can stand upright without assistance. They typically come with a seat that can be adjusted to a variety of recline positions, as well as safety straps that can be used to secure your child. The pushchair, also referred to as strollers and buggies, can be used as soon as your baby is able to sit up unaided.

When purchasing the pram or pushchair make sure that it meets the Australian Standard (AS/NZS 2088). If the product doesn't meet the requirements of this standard, your baby may be injured if it is rolled away. Also you should look for a safe locking mechanism with a primary and a secondary parking brake as well as red levers for parking. It is also important to ensure that the chassis has a wrist tether strap for children.
